复习1.守护进程2.互斥锁(解决数据错乱的方法)3.IPC(进程间通讯)4.生产者与消费者模型详解:1.守护进程 一个进程可以设为另一个进程的守护进程 特点:被守护的进程结束时,守护进程也会随之结束 本质:父进程交给子进程一个任务,然而父进程 先于子进程结束了,子进程的任务也就没有必要 继续执行了 ...
分类:
编程语言 时间:
2019-06-04 16:14:37
阅读次数:
157
socket API原本是为网络通讯设计的,但后来在socket的框架上发展出一种IPC机制,就是UNIX Domain Socket。虽然网络socket也可用于同一台主机的进程间通讯(通过loopback地址127.0.0.1),但是UNIX Domain Socket用于IPC更有效率:不需要 ...
分类:
系统相关 时间:
2019-05-25 20:00:25
阅读次数:
177
python multiprocessing模块 原文地址 multiprocessing Process类 进程的调用 进程同步 注意:这里使用锁需要把锁传递进函数,因为是使用的是不同的进程,这里有复制拷贝!!! 进程间通讯 进程对列Queue 管道 The Pipe() function ret ...
分类:
编程语言 时间:
2019-05-06 16:06:25
阅读次数:
151
网络是Linux系统最核心的功能,网络把计算机或局域网连接到一起,本质上是一种进程间通讯的方式,特别是跨系统的进程间通讯,必须通过网络。 网络模型 网络中常提起的有七层负载均衡,四层负载均衡,三层设备,二层设备。 这些层来自于国际标准组织定制的 开放式系统互联通讯参考模型(Open systen I ...
分类:
系统相关 时间:
2019-05-05 17:08:09
阅读次数:
155
进程:资源单位,由操作系统控制调度。正在执行的一个程序或者过程,进程之间不共享资源,进程间通讯手段:管道,队列,信号量等。多用于计算密集型场景,如金融计算 线程:是cpu的最小执行单位,由操作系统控制调度。一个进程至少有一个线程,同一个进程里面的多个线程共享该进程的内存资源(此处会涉及到资源的抢夺) ...
分类:
编程语言 时间:
2019-04-25 22:44:08
阅读次数:
212
完整原文:http://tryenough.com/android ipc1 Android开发的进程间通讯,整个Android的应用都依赖于binder做底层通信机制。而Linux中提供的进程间通讯方式并没有binder机制,那么android中为什么要单独创造这种通讯方式呢?带着这个问题,继续往 ...
分类:
移动开发 时间:
2019-02-22 21:19:54
阅读次数:
232
一、守护进程 二、互斥锁 三、抢票 四、进程间通讯 五、进程间通讯2 一、守护进程 二、互斥锁 三、抢票 四、进程间通讯 五、进程间通讯2 小结: 1.守护进程 ** a守护b b如果死了 a也就跟着死了 2.互斥锁 ****** 为什么使用锁? 当多个进程对统一资源进行读写时 引发了数据错乱 解决 ...
分类:
编程语言 时间:
2019-02-04 10:22:38
阅读次数:
167
目录 4.3.1 概念 4.3.2 创建/方法 4.3.3 生产者消费者模型 4.3.1 概念原理 4.3.2 创建/方法 进程间通讯示例 import time from multiprocessing import Process, Queue def f(q): q.put([time.asc ...
分类:
其他好文 时间:
2019-01-31 01:36:21
阅读次数:
161
转自‘https://www.cnblogs.com/makaruila/p/4869912.html 平时一说进程间通讯,大家都会想到AIDL,其实messenger和AIDL作用一样,都可以进行进程间通讯。它是基于消息的进程间通信,就像子线程和UI线程发送消息那样,是不是很简单,还不用去写AID ...
分类:
移动开发 时间:
2019-01-06 15:37:26
阅读次数:
272
套接字socket 套接字起源于 20 世纪 70 年代加利福尼亚大学伯克利分校版本的 Unix,即人们所说的 BSD Unix。 因此,有时人们也把套接字称为“伯克利套接字”或“BSD 套接字”。一开始,套接字被设计用在同 一台主机上多个应用程序之间的通讯。这也被称进程间通讯,或 IPC。套接字有 ...
分类:
编程语言 时间:
2018-12-08 11:34:54
阅读次数:
188